A Glorious Traditionally Styled Home Spacious Home in an enviable location which must be seen .
This superb much improved Traditionally styled Detached family home, enjoys an elevated position with attractive views towards the Malvern Hills.
Having been in the same family for over Twenty Four years this much loved home enjoys one of the areas most sought after locations to the South West of the City Centre of Wolverhampton.
The property offers lovingly cared for high quality accommodation with a wonderful flow, to include, an inviting Reception Hall with a composite door windows to the front attractive original Oak wood flooring, radiator and a most useful under stair storage cupboard .
Stunning Living Room, having a double glazed bay window to the front ,radiator, original picture rail, coved ceiling and a feature open fireplace with marble hearth.
Sitting Room Having double glazed windows and double patio doors giving views and access to the beautiful rear garden, radiator and a feature fireplace with marble hearth.
Impressive L shaped Dining Kitchen with a ranges of wall and base light oak units in the Charles Rennie Mackintosh art nouveau shaker style, Neff gas hob with an extraction chimney ,Built Bosch 0ven , separate Bosch Microwave. Plumbing for a dishwasher an inset one and a half bowl sink with insinkerator, two built in Fridge Freezers ,double glazed French doors with surrounding windows giving views and access to the rear garden a door to the laundry and garage. Downstairs Shower Room with Vanity Sink unit and W.c.
Laundry and Garage with plumbing for an automatic washer .
A feature staircase rises from the hallway to the L shaped landing
Bedroom One. This is a well proportioned bedroom has a walk in bay window to the front, radiator and coved ceiling with plaster detailing
Bedroom Two this excellent Double bedroom has a double glazed window overlooking the rear garden, a seating area fitted wardrobes and ceiling cornice.
Bedroom Three /Study. This delightful room has a window to the rear and ceiling cornice.
Bedroom Four. Presently used as a Gym with a rear facing window radiator and ceiling cornice.
Luxury Well appointed Bathroom .with a panelled Bath with mixer shower above  pedestal wash basin, W.c. cork tile flooring  ,down lighting  and an obscure glazed window to the front .
Shower Room with W.c and vanity unit with inset wash basin .
A staircase from the landing rises to the Master Bedroom Suite having dual aspect Velux windows giving panoramic views to the rear towards the Malvern Hills. Bathroom with W.c  and vanity unit with inset wash hand basin .
Outside . An outstanding feature of this beautiful home is the stunning Rear garden. having a shaped rear terrace with sitting and dining area three sun awnings a top lawn there is a larger lawned area with well stocked flower beds and borders sandstone walling  a timber garden shed , greenhouse  an outside power point and tap .
The front Garden has a block paved driveway raised flower borders  leading to a garage with elevating door .
This is without doubt a beautiful and appealing family home set in lovely grounds the viewing of which is strongly advised .

    Broadband availability and predicted speed: obtained from Ofcom on February 10, 2022

    Broadband speed is measured in megabits per second, with the number returned showing how fast the connection is. Each reading is based on the highest predicted speed of any major broadband network for services that deliver the download speeds. The following are the different readings that we may display:

    Basic: Up to 30 Mbit/s
    Super-fast: Between 30 Mbit/s and 300 Mbit/s
    Ultra-fast: Over 300 Mbit/s

    The data is updated three times a year. The checker results are predictions and should not be regarded as guaranteed. For more information, see: https://checker.ofcom.org.uk/en-gb/about-checker#Answer_0_2

    Mobile phone signal availability and predicted strength: obtained from Ofcom on February 10, 2022

    Mobile signal predictions are provided by the four UK mobile network operators: EE, O2, Three and Vodafone. Predictions can vary significantly from the coverage you may actually experience as a result of local factors (especially terrain). Ofcom has tested the actual coverage provided in various locations around the UK to help ensure that these predictions are reasonable. The values shown against a property can be broken down as follows:

    Clear: No bars, no signal predicted
    Red: One bar, reliable signal unlikely
    Amber: Two bars, may experience problems with connectivity
    Green: Three bars, likely to have good coverage and receive a data rate to support basic web services
    Enhanced: Full bars, likely to have good coverage indoors and to receive an enhanced data rate to support multimedia services
